The adhesion railway relies on a combination of friction and weight to start a train. The heaviest trains require the highest friction and the heaviest locomotive. The friction can vary a great deal, but it was known on early railways that sand helped, and it is still used today, even on locomotives with modern traction controls.

Slippery rail, or low railhead adhesion, [1] [2] [3] is a condition of railways (railroads) where contamination of the railhead reduces the traction between the wheel and the rail. This can lead to wheelslip when the train is taking power, and wheelslide when the train is braking.

Wheel flats on railway vehicles are very evident by a distinct “bang-bang” noise made in time with the speed of the train.
